STEM Diversity and the Case for Doubling H-1B Visa Slots
Introduction
The U.S. has long been a global leader in science, technology, engineering, and mathematics (STEM). This dominance is no accident—it is the result of a diverse, collaborative workforce that includes some of the brightest minds from around the world. The H-1B visa program plays a pivotal role in this success, allowing highly skilled foreign professionals to work in the U.S. and contribute to its innovation ecosystem. However, the annual cap of 85,000 H-1B visas is woefully insufficient to meet the demands of a rapidly evolving global economy.
To sustain U.S. leadership in STEM and spur innovation, it is time to double the H-1B visa cap. Far from stifling opportunities for homegrown talent, this expansion would foster a more dynamic, collaborative, and innovative STEM workforce while nurturing the next generation of American scientists and engineers.
The Importance of H-1B Talent in U.S. STEM
H-1B visa holders are vital to STEM fields, where demand for expertise often exceeds the supply of qualified U.S. workers. These professionals:
- Fill critical gaps: H-1B workers bring specialized skills in areas like artificial intelligence, biotechnology, and quantum computing, where domestic talent is often scarce.
- Drive innovation: Many H-1B visa holders work in research-intensive industries, leading breakthroughs that benefit society and the economy.
- Support economic growth: Studies show that H-1B workers contribute significantly to job creation, with each visa holder generating additional jobs in the U.S.

Addressing Common Concerns
Some critics argue that expanding the H-1B program could disadvantage domestic workers. However, the evidence does not support this claim:
- Job creation: H-1B workers often complement, rather than replace, domestic employees. Their contributions lead to the growth of entire industries, creating more opportunities for U.S.-born workers.
- Wage growth: Studies have shown that H-1B visa holders contribute to economic growth, which helps raise wages across the board.
- Education pipeline: H-1B professionals inspire and train American students, helping to build a stronger pipeline of homegrown STEM talent.
